About M.T. Costa

M.T. Costa is a scholar working on Biochemistry, Clinical Biochemistry and Physiology, having authored 16 papers that have together received 347 indexed citations. Recurring topics across this work include Amino Acid Enzymes and Metabolism (6 papers), Polyamine Metabolism and Applications (6 papers), Glycosylation and Glycoproteins Research (4 papers), Enzyme function and inhibition (3 papers), Nitric Oxide and Endothelin Effects (2 papers), Metabolism and Genetic Disorders (2 papers), Lipid Membrane Structure and Behavior (2 papers) and Lysosomal Storage Disorders Research (2 papers). The work is most often cited by research in Biochemistry (112 citations), Molecular Biology (257 citations) and Cell Biology (57 citations). M.T. Costa has collaborated with scholars based in Italy, Portugal and United States. Frequent co-authors include Bruno Mondovı̀, Giuseppe Rotilio, Alessandro Finazzi Agrò, Alessandro Finazzi‐Agrò, Helmut Beinert, Emilia Chiancone, Raymond E. Hansen, Júlia Costa, Francisco Diniz Affonso da Costa and Michelle F. Susin. Their work appears in journals such as Journal of Biological Chemistry, Biochemical Journal and FEBS Letters.
